Hi Bepi,

There are several possibilities here.  First, you say that you are
using Galileo (Eclipse 3.5), but you have the 3.4 stream of AJDT
installed.  They are not compatible and I am surprised that you have
them installed together.  Perhaps you have mistakenly included the
wrong version of one or the other.

Second, is JDT Weaving enabled?  Look at your preferences page under
JDT Weaving.  It must be enabled for you to use this feature.
